Fully vaccinated Queenslanders who test positive will be allowed to isolate at home

Fully vaccinated Queenslanders infected with COVID-19 will be allowed to isolate at home, rather than in hospital, under a new regime in 2022 when the virus is expected to be widely circulating in the state.
